Highest Education Level
Director of Securitys in Dulles, VA off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
35.0%
Master's Degree
18.5%
High School or GED
15.8%
Associate's Degree
12.6%
Vocational Degree or Certification
11.9%
Doctorate Degree
2.9%
Some College
2.8%
Some High School
0.5%
